Crawl Space Solutions
In the greater Virginia Beach area, there are many homes that were built with crawl spaces in addition to basements. As long as there have been crawl spaces, these were constructed with open vents to the outside where were intended to help fresh air flow through the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, this is rarely what happens. Having open vents allows water to get in when it rains or snows and the vents hinder airflow which causes the humidity levels to stay high which can harbor the growth of mildew. Studies have shown that up to 50% of the air in your home has come up through the crawl space so having the space closed off from the elements and controlling excess humidity can increase the overall air quality in your home.
Our team has been dealing with crawl spaces since we opened our doors and we know the proper way to seal them off and control high humidity. We do this using a process known as encapsulation which is the installation of a heavy duty liner, sometimes accompanied by insulation products, and are strong plastic and vinyl sheets as well as vent covers and a sturdy door that can seal the area totally and stop any excess mo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also stop pests and animals from moving in your crawl space which will keep any appliances there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Once your crawl space is encapsulated, if necessary we can install a series of sagging floor jacks to lift sagging floors above the crawl space.
Structural Foundation Repair
The foundation of your home is easily one of, if not the, most important areas of the home. It not only holds the structure itself but it also forms the basement walls. If you have any foundation problems, they will generally show themselves as stair-step cracks in your outside brickwork, long cracks that run the length of the foundation or across the basement walls. You may also notice that your windows will not open or close easily or even cracks at the corners of them. You may not think these problems seem serious when you notice them, they are all indicators of a sinking or settling foundation and they should be evaluated by an expert for particular problems and determine what type of a repair needs to be installed.
It is good that many foundation problems are caused by similar things and our experts are very good at tracking down these problems. We can implement a repair solution designed for your specific problem to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ation. If there is a sloping foundation, we can install a series of foundation piers to correct the problem. The location and amount of sinking will determine if we use helical or push piers. Both types are very strong and can stabilize your foundation.
